Cyclocytidine chemotherapy for malignant melanoma
Summary
Cyclocytidine chemotherapy showed a low response rate of 4% in patients with metastatic malignant melanoma. This treatment also presented unusual toxic effects, including delayed thrombocytopenia and hypotension.
Area of Science:
- Oncology
- Pharmacology
Background:
- Metastatic malignant melanoma is an advanced form of skin cancer with limited treatment options.
- Patients with advanced melanoma often receive extensive prior chemotherapy, impacting subsequent treatment efficacy.
Purpose of the Study:
- To evaluate the efficacy and toxicity of cyclocytidine in patients with metastatic malignant melanoma previously treated with chemotherapy.
Main Methods:
- A cohort of 29 patients with metastatic malignant melanoma received cyclocytidine at a dose of 240 mg/m2/day subcutaneously for 10 days.
- Patient response and adverse events were closely monitored.
Main Results:
- The overall response rate (complete plus partial remission) was low at 4%, with only one patient achieving a partial remission.
- Unusual toxic effects were observed, including delayed onset of thrombocytopenia, orthostatic hypotension, and jaw pain.
Conclusions:
- Cyclocytidine demonstrated limited efficacy as a salvage therapy for heavily pre-treated metastatic malignant melanoma patients.
- The observed unusual toxicities warrant further investigation and careful patient monitoring during cyclocytidine treatment.
